The Atlanta Hawks have become one of the league’s most exciting teams, currently fifth in the Eastern Conference.
Key Hawks players to watch include Jalen Johnson, a versatile point forward, and Nickeil Alexander-Walker, who has flourished in the Hawks' offense.
Injury reports indicate several Nets players are out, while the Hawks will miss Jock Landale.
Onyeka Okongwu is expected to play a significant role for the Hawks, especially with Landale out. Betting odds favor Okongwu exceeding his points prop.
Why this matters: This game provides insights into the Hawks' potential playoff impact and the Nets' strategic approach to the draft lottery. Keep an eye on player performances, especially Alexander-Walker and Okongwu, as they could significantly influence the game's outcome and future team strategies.
The Atlanta Hawks have emerged as a formidable team, showcasing a potent offense and a solid defense. Their success is attributed to the development of players like Jalen Johnson and the effective integration of Nickeil Alexander-Walker into their system. The Brooklyn Nets, on the other hand, are in a rebuilding phase, focusing on securing a high draft pick to bolster their future prospects.
The game will likely hinge on the performance of the Hawks' key players and how well the Nets can contain them. Onyeka Okongwu's role is particularly important given Landale's injury, and his ability to score and rebound will be crucial for the Hawks. For the Nets, players like Nolan Traore and Nic Claxton will need to step up to challenge the Hawks.
The Hawks are heavily favored, with a significant point spread. Betting trends indicate that the Nets struggle as double-digit underdogs. Prop bets on players like Okongwu are also noteworthy, reflecting expectations of strong individual performances.
